Online poker has grown tremendously over the last decade, becoming one of the most popular card games in the digital gambling world. Unlike traditional poker played in casinos or home games, online poker allows players to compete from anywhere, offering convenience and accessibility.
The appeal of online poker lies in its combination of skill, strategy, and luck. Players face off against other participants rather than the house, making decision-making, reading opponents, and understanding probabilities key factors in success. This strategic element provides an intellectually stimulating and rewarding experience.
There are several variations of online poker, including Texas Hold’em, Omaha, and Seven-Card Stud. Each variation has unique rules, strategies, and levels of complexity, allowing players to select games that match their experience and preference. Texas Hold’em is especially popular due to its balance of skill and excitement, frequently featured in major online tournaments.
Online platforms cater to both beginners and experienced players. Beginners can start at low-stakes tables to learn rules and strategies without risking significant funds. Many platforms also provide tutorials and demo games to practice and build confidence before entering real-money games. Experienced players can join high-stakes tables and tournaments with large prize pools, testing their skills against other skilled participants.
Tournaments are an integral part of online poker. Sit & Go tournaments, multi-table tournaments, and scheduled events provide structured gameplay with opportunities for substantial prizes. Some platforms also offer satellite tournaments granting access to prestigious live events, bridging the gap between online and offline poker.
Mobile accessibility further enhances the appeal of online poker. Players can participate anytime, anywhere, with optimized mobile platforms ensuring smooth gameplay. Many platforms provide statistics, hand histories, and analytics tools that allow players to review strategies and improve performance over time.
Security and fairness are essential for online poker. Reputable platforms use encryption technology to protect user data, while certified random number generators ensure fair card distribution. Players can enjoy the game confidently, knowing outcomes are unbiased.
